Skip to content

Commit 81d38a3

Browse files
authored
Merge pull request #6 from gravity-ui/use-gravity-ui-packages
feat: migrate from yandex-cloud to gravity-ui
2 parents 01960a6 + 9d30c31 commit 81d38a3

File tree

35 files changed

+1971
-2463
lines changed

35 files changed

+1971
-2463
lines changed

.eslintrc

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,4 +1,4 @@
11
{
2-
"extends": ["@yandex-cloud/eslint-config", "@yandex-cloud/eslint-config/prettier"],
2+
"extends": ["@gravity-ui/eslint-config", "@gravity-ui/eslint-config/prettier"],
33
"root": true
44
}

.prettierrc.js

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1 +1 @@
1-
module.exports = require('@yandex-cloud/prettier-config');
1+
module.exports = require('@gravity-ui/prettier-config');

.storybook/addons/addon-yaml/register.js

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-3,7 +3,7 @@ import {addons, types} from '@storybook/addons';
33
import {AddonPanel} from '@storybook/components';
44
import {useArgs} from '@storybook/api';
55
import yaml from 'js-yaml';
6-
import {ClipboardButton} from '@yandex-cloud/uikit';
6+
import {ClipboardButton} from '@gravity-ui/uikit';
77

88
import './AddonYaml.css';
99

.storybook/decorators/withMobile.tsx

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,6 +1,6 @@
11
import React from 'react';
22
import {Story as StoryType, StoryContext} from '@storybook/react/types-6-0';
3-
import {useMobile} from '@yandex-cloud/uikit';
3+
import {useMobile} from '@gravity-ui/uikit';
44

55
export function withMobile(Story: StoryType, context: StoryContext) {
66
const mobileValue = context.globals.platform === 'mobile';

.storybook/preview.tsx

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-1,6 +1,6 @@
11
import '../styles/storybook/index.scss';
2-
import '@yandex-cloud/uikit/styles/styles.scss';
3-
import {MobileProvider, Platform} from '@yandex-cloud/uikit';
2+
import '@gravity-ui/uikit/styles/styles.scss';
3+
import {MobileProvider, Platform} from '@gravity-ui/uikit';
44

55
import React from 'react';
66
import {MINIMAL_VIEWPORTS} from '@storybook/addon-viewport';

.stylelintrc

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,3 +1,3 @@
11
{
2-
"extends": ["@yandex-cloud/stylelint-config", "@yandex-cloud/stylelint-config/prettier"]
2+
"extends": ["@gravity-ui/stylelint-config", "@gravity-ui/stylelint-config/prettier"]
33
}

CHANGELOG.md

Lines changed: 3 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-157,7 +157,7 @@
157157
- У компонента Button убран отступ сверху
158158
- Добавлены миксины для заголовков
159159
- Добавлена переменная `--pc-text-header-color` со значением `var(--yc-color-text-primary)`
160-
- Обновлена версия @yandex-cloud/uikit до 2.3.0
160+
- Обновлена версия @gravity-ui/uikit до 2.3.0
161161

162162
## 0.39.2
163163

@@ -187,9 +187,9 @@
187187

188188
### Breaking changes
189189

190-
- Добавлен пакет `@yandex-cloud/uikit`
190+
- Добавлен пакет `@gravity-ui/uikit`
191191
- Обновлен пакет `@yandex-data-ui/common`
192-
- Заменен пакет в peer dependencies `@yandex-data-ui/i18n` -> `@yandex-cloud/i18n`
192+
- Заменен пакет в peer dependencies `@yandex-data-ui/i18n` -> `@gravity-ui/i18n`
193193
- Пакет react-router-dom удален из зависимостей
194194

195195
## 0.33.0

package-lock.json

Lines changed: 1919 additions & 2414 deletions
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

package.json

Lines changed: 14 additions & 14 deletions
Original file line numberDiff line numberDiff line change
@@ -25,7 +25,7 @@
2525
"lint:fix": "run-s lint:js:fix lint:styles:fix lint:prettier:fix typecheck",
2626
"lint:js": "eslint '**/*.{js,jsx,ts,tsx}' --max-warnings=0",
2727
"lint:js:fix": "eslint '**/*.{js,jsx,ts,tsx}' --max-warnings=0 --quiet --fix",
28-
"lint:styles": "stylelint '{styles,src}/**/*.scss' -s scss",
28+
"lint:styles": "stylelint '{styles,src}/**/*.scss'",
2929
"lint:styles:fix": "stylelint **/*.scss -s scss --fix",
3030
"lint:prettier": "prettier --check '**/*.{js,jsx,ts,tsx,css,scss,json,yaml,yml,md}'",
3131
"lint:prettier:fix": "prettier --write '**/*.{js,jsx,ts,tsx,css,scss,json,yaml,yml,md}'",
@@ -55,15 +55,21 @@
5555
"typograf": "^6.14.0"
5656
},
5757
"peerDependencies": {
58-
"@yandex-cloud/uikit": "^2.12.0",
59-
"@yandex-cloud/i18n": "^0.6.0",
60-
"@doc-tools/transform": "^2.6.1",
61-
"react": "^16.0.0"
58+
"react": "^16.0.0",
59+
"@gravity-ui/uikit": "^3.0.1",
60+
"@gravity-ui/i18n": "^1.0.0",
61+
"@doc-tools/transform": "^2.6.1"
6262
},
6363
"devDependencies": {
6464
"@commitlint/cli": "^17.1.2",
6565
"@commitlint/config-conventional": "^17.1.0",
6666
"@doc-tools/transform": "^2.12.0",
67+
"@gravity-ui/eslint-config": "^1.0.2",
68+
"@gravity-ui/i18n": "^1.0.0",
69+
"@gravity-ui/prettier-config": "^1.0.1",
70+
"@gravity-ui/stylelint-config": "^1.0.0",
71+
"@gravity-ui/tsconfig": "^1.0.0",
72+
"@gravity-ui/uikit": "^3.0.1",
6773
"@storybook/addon-actions": "^6.3.12",
6874
"@storybook/addon-essentials": "^6.5.10",
6975
"@storybook/addon-knobs": "^6.3.1",
@@ -75,12 +81,6 @@
7581
"@types/react-slick": "^0.23.7",
7682
"@types/react-transition-group": "^4.4.4",
7783
"@types/sanitize-html": "^2.6.0",
78-
"@yandex-cloud/eslint-config": "^1.0.1",
79-
"@yandex-cloud/i18n": "^0.6.0",
80-
"@yandex-cloud/prettier-config": "^1.0.0",
81-
"@yandex-cloud/stylelint-config": "^1.1.1",
82-
"@yandex-cloud/tsconfig": "^1.0.0",
83-
"@yandex-cloud/uikit": "^2.12.0",
8484
"eslint": "^7.32.0",
8585
"eslint-plugin-local": "./eslint-plugin-local",
8686
"gulp": "^4.0.2",
@@ -94,16 +94,16 @@
9494
"markdown-loader": "^6.0.0",
9595
"move-file-cli": "^3.0.0",
9696
"npm-run-all": "^4.1.5",
97-
"postcss": "^8.4.14",
97+
"postcss": "^8.4.16",
98+
"postcss-scss": "^4.0.4",
9899
"prettier": "2.4.1",
99100
"react": "^18.2.0",
100101
"react-docgen-typescript": "^2.2.2",
101102
"react-dom": "^18.2.0",
102103
"rimraf": "^3.0.2",
103104
"sass": "^1.54.4",
104105
"sass-loader": "^10.3.1",
105-
"stylelint": "^13.13.1",
106-
"stylelint-scss": "^3.21.0",
106+
"stylelint": "^14.11.0",
107107
"svg-sprite-loader": "^6.0.11",
108108
"tslib": "^2.4.0",
109109
"typescript": "4.4.4",

src/.eslintrc

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,5 +1,5 @@
11
{
2-
"extends": "@yandex-cloud/eslint-config/client",
2+
"extends": "@gravity-ui/eslint-config/client",
33
"env": {
44
"node": true
55
}

0 commit comments

Comments
 (0)